ISM Graduation RequirementsISM Graduation Requirements(MINIMUM) – *think of 1 credit = 1 year(MINIMUM) – *think of 1 credit = 1 year

SUBJECT MIN. REQUIRED # of CREDITS

English 4

Math 2

Science 2

Social Studies 2

Modern Languages 2

Fine & Performing Arts 2

Physical Education 2

Wellness/Computer Literacy 1

Electives 6

TOTAL 23

IB Subject Flow (Science)IB Subject Flow (Science)Integrated Science 1

combines and integrates the three content areas of biology, chemistry and physics.

In grade 10 you will have the choice of continuing with Integrated Science 2 or specializing with a full year course in either biology, chemistry or physics.

Other Advice?Other Advice?Fine & Performing Arts BlockIf you are planning to do an IB Group 6 Arts

(Art, Film or Theater) in grade 11, we recommend that you take the “Intro” course in that area in grade 9 (Intro Art, Intro Theater or Intro Film).

Your ElectiveUnfortunately, you do not have an elective as

a grade 9. You will have one as a grade 10.

What colleges want to see?What colleges want to see?They want to see that you are challenging

yourself to the best of your ability with the courses you select.

They want to see the best possible grades you are capable of achieving.

This allows them to “predict” how successful you could be at their college.

They want to see a well round individual that contributes to their high school and community.
